Michelle rated it: 1 of 5 stars
As a bare bones teaser, this fails. I have so little desire to read the actual books that I will avoid this author. Why? "Apparently" was used three times in one paragraph. The dialog is stilted and full of the "Hello, [insert name]" that adds nothing except word count. The heroine describes herself and her clothing head to foot often enough that I wonder if this should have been a comic instead. Amanda rated it: 2 of 5 stars
This was an ok story. Nothing fabulous. Not impressed enough to consider purchasing the first book in the Heaven and Hell series. It had a feel of most teen novels, the not so great ones. The girl's name is actually Heven. Ugh. Very unoriginal. This was just a free short story introducing the characters for the series. The monster that Sam speaks of working for was a bit interesting just because they never mention what exactly the monster was. I'd like to know but I'm not dying to know.
